when i join my autojoin channels on connect, my mirc automatically does a /who in a few of them. i was wondering if anyone could tell me how to make it not do this. thanks!

It's probably a script you have loaded. Type /!remote off and see if it stops it. If it does then it's your script, either remove it or try this:

Type alt+r and search for "who #" or "who $chan" (or perhaps just "who" on its own) and see if you find anything, you can then put a ; at the start of the line to stop mIRC performing the /who. This may cause problems, depending on the script you have loaded.

Type /!remote on to turn your scripts back on.
